A racoon will move to different locations for one of two reasons.

1. Food (self explanatory)

2. Territory (Racoons are "clannish", meaning they stick together in family clans. If one clan encounters another in it's territory, the weaker of the two clans will be forced to find a new territory to inhabit.)

If a raccoon has become imprinted on humans as a source of food they might approach a person. This is why it is highly recommended not to feed wild animals. They become accustomed to obtaining food from humans and do not use their own foraging skills. In some jurisdictions it is against the law to feed wildlife.
